Ryan VanderMeulen
75acd49b0e
Backed out 8 changesets (bug 716403) for frequent Android mochitest-8 failures on a CLOSED TREE.
2013-03-01 16:09:59 -05:00
Chris Lord
08f9e1089b
Bug 716403 - Use setContentDocumentFixedPositionMargins in Android's browser.js. r=kats
...
This uses the aforementioned method on nsIDOMWindowUtils to make sure layout's
idea of the fixed position margins matches those used in the compositor.
2013-03-01 15:46:34 +00:00
Chris Lord
413fbf7cd0
Bug 716403 - Resize viewport dynamically on Android. r=kats,mfinkle
...
This causes the viewport size to differ, depending on the length of the page.
This has the effect of pages that size themselves to the size of the window
always having the toolbar visible, making sites like Google Maps more usable.
2013-03-01 15:46:34 +00:00
Wes Johnston
41efaaf7cd
Bug 768035 - Implement SiteSpecificUserAgent for Fennec. r=bnicholson
2013-02-28 14:02:21 -08:00
Gregory Szorc
803629b9c6
Merge mozilla-central into build-system
...
There were merges in configure.in and some Makefile.in. None had any
conflicts. I spot verified the Makefile.in changes and confirmed that
the changes did not touch any DIRS* variables.
2013-02-27 10:03:52 -08:00
Gregory Szorc
16f0413b0c
Merge mozilla-central into build-system
...
Only conflict was configure.in amd was due to context, not
changed lines themselves.
2013-02-25 22:09:18 -08:00
Gregory Szorc
d71cc11e47
Bug 784841 - Part 18w: Convert /mobile/android; r=ted
2013-02-25 12:47:23 -08:00
Margaret Leibovic
3d251e87e5
Bug 842883 - (Part 4) Replace DOMWindowClose event with Tab:Close. r=mfinkle
2013-02-24 20:51:05 -08:00
Margaret Leibovic
87d6ac0b5a
Bug 842883 - (Part 3) Move Content:* events from GeckoApp to Tabs. r=bnicholson
2013-02-24 20:51:05 -08:00
Margaret Leibovic
d82959f60f
Bug 842883 - (Part 1) Start moving some tab-specific event listeners to Tabs. r=bnicholson
2013-02-24 20:51:04 -08:00
Margaret Leibovic
5e4e5e897b
Bug 843821 - Support reading distribution resources from a /system location. r=mfinkle
2013-02-24 20:15:23 -08:00
Kartikaya Gupta
add4b29c97
Bug 842946 - When there is no selected tab, don't try to apply viewport updates. r=mfinkle
2013-02-25 14:40:44 -05:00
Margaret Leibovic
8a60a5cf5d
Bug 845075 - Move more tab-specific event handlers from GeckoApp to Tabs. r=mfinkle
2013-02-26 11:50:04 -08:00
Wes Johnston
17c0a8c6e1
Bug 840703 - Remove unnecessary menulist binding from Fennec. r=mbrubeck
2013-02-22 16:05:34 -08:00
Wes Johnston
8ef3f5fc3f
Bug 839771 - Use a compound drawable to add padding to select elements. r=sriram
2013-02-21 08:41:41 -08:00
Panos Astithas
0dc80bb350
Bug 818382 - Support chrome debugging in Firefox for Android; r=mfinkle
2013-02-21 08:44:03 +02:00
Kartikaya Gupta
9aae1a8e20
Back out b3bdec87d963 (bug 840722) for causing bug 842418. r=me
2013-02-19 16:11:03 -05:00
Margaret Leibovic
b8644f7bb6
Bug 840825 - Basic tests for distribution customization. r=gbrown,wesj
2013-02-19 10:15:55 -08:00
Kartikaya Gupta
02904237fe
Bug 841810 - Allow java addons to receive and respond to events. r=mfinkle
2013-02-15 15:21:41 -05:00
Tetsuharu OHZEKI
ff4ae413b9
Bug 840722 - Add an object which represents the viewport metadata in browser.js.r=kats
2013-02-15 15:20:52 -05:00
Yury Delendik
92e8ade290
Bug 839714 - Extend PlayPreview API. r=jschoenick, r=jwein
2013-02-14 15:38:41 -06:00
Wes Johnston
3c9398e416
Bug 830760 - Don't zoom into fields on tablets of pages with metaviewports. r=kats DONTBUILD
2013-02-13 11:36:29 -08:00
Wes Johnston
e8e523f2da
backout 28c0078a4d76 to fix commit message
2013-02-13 11:42:09 -08:00
Wes Johnston
537f780db5
Bug 83760 - Disable zoom into fields on tablets and pags with metaviewport. r=kats
...
* * *
Bug 830760 - Don't zoom into fields on tablets or pages with metaviewports. r=kats
2013-02-13 11:36:29 -08:00
Mark Finkle
4c54c12f59
Bug 835399 - Allow launching non-privileged webapps with a URL r=wesj
2013-02-13 10:26:03 -05:00
Brian Nicholson
fb24943e81
Bug 840823 - Check whether new tabs were made from stubs to prevent removal race condition. r=mfinkle
2013-02-12 23:48:32 -08:00
Brian Nicholson
b7a7de0fbc
Bug 840601 - Clear saved reader mode page in tab destroy. r=kats
2013-02-12 23:44:40 -08:00
Tetsuharu OHZEKI
41305e7902
Bug 840312 - Cache the result of Tab.metadata. r=kats
2013-02-12 16:19:43 +09:00
Kartikaya Gupta
d966ecc5da
Bug 833777 - Guard against selectedTab being null when Gecko goes into the background. r=bnicholson
2013-02-11 23:24:41 -05:00
Tetsuharu OHZEKI
1f77b14c31
Bug 833003 - Use metadata.scaleRatio as its value if viewport metadata.defaultZoom has no value. r=kats
2013-02-11 18:15:18 -05:00
Mark Capella
e2922dbaea
Bug 836451 - Add distribution info to about:firefox, r=margaret
2013-02-08 14:29:21 -05:00
Mark Finkle
ed003a1502
Bug 839242 - Remove unused onunload handler from about:apps r=margaret
2013-02-08 00:36:50 -05:00
Christian Vielma
b06ea4e13a
Bug 454880 - Allow access to recent history through back/forward buttons. r=bnicholson
...
--HG--
extra : rebase_source : c871a1f0b464db10b5bd22a27f7783ba1c53c213
2013-02-06 22:53:01 -05:00
Brian Nicholson
aa4bfb51f7
Bug 777639 - Part 4: Listen for removed downloads in about:downloads. r=wesj
...
--HG--
extra : rebase_source : c1f83dc5708f7b930e33e0644a19dffb86aa9be8
2013-02-05 16:08:10 -08:00
Brian Nicholson
8b10c42551
Bug 777639 - Part 3: Add ability to delete downloaded files. r=mfinkle
...
--HG--
rename : mobile/android/chrome/content/sanitize.js => mobile/android/modules/Sanitizer.jsm
extra : rebase_source : c147efb303a2435823690ca70731b58e528fc6f1
2013-02-05 16:08:03 -08:00
Brian Nicholson
149935fcae
Bug 777639 - Part 2: Move sanitize.js to Sanitizer.jsm. r=mfinkle
...
--HG--
rename : mobile/android/chrome/content/sanitize.js => mobile/android/modules/Sanitizer.jsm
extra : rebase_source : 09a198591376de7f652ce2e594fffca790eeb629
2013-02-05 16:08:02 -08:00
Brian Nicholson
de245e9003
Bug 777639 - Part 1: Remove unused code from Sanitizer. r=mfinkle
...
--HG--
rename : content/media/MediaStreamGraphImpl.h => content/media/MediaStreamGraph.cpp
rename : dom/voicemail/Makefile.in => dom/telephony/Makefile.in
rename : dom/voicemail/nsINavigatorVoicemail.idl => dom/telephony/nsIDOMNavigatorTelephony.idl
extra : rebase_source : 378be91fbad3d04e80f130bdcd26b2e4accd5340
2013-02-05 16:08:01 -08:00
Mark Finkle
a15a3491e3
Bug 835399 - Remove use of promises in WebAppRT r=bnicholson
2013-02-05 08:48:15 -05:00
Mark Finkle
b3e2783b19
Bug 835399 - Rename isAppUpdate to startupStatus r=bnicholson
2013-02-05 08:48:13 -05:00
Brian Nicholson
b2869b4956
Bug 837848 - Remove gecko property from handleGeckoMessage calls. r=mfinkle
2013-02-04 13:22:30 -08:00
Shriram Kunchanapalli
200e7b9cd9
Bug 702796: IndexedDB prompt should auto-dismiss after a timeout [in native fennec]. r=mbrubeck
2013-02-02 22:59:16 +05:30
Brian Nicholson
bbfab44dd6
Bug 837042 - Remove gecko property from sendMessageToJava. r=mfinkle
...
--HG--
extra : rebase_source : 49a739f7550a3afe83b19518833de03a014e2a80
2013-02-01 17:36:38 -08:00
Margaret Leibovic
91e2609853
Bug 836838 - Avoid race condition in distribution initialization. r=bnicholson,mfinkle
2013-02-01 15:45:33 -08:00
Margaret Leibovic
5cd6d076d0
Bug 836517 - Lightweight theme support for distributions. r=mfinkle
2013-02-01 15:45:33 -08:00
Margaret Leibovic
ae1909b998
Bug 834681 - Add support for basic distribution modifications. r=mfinkle
2013-02-01 15:45:33 -08:00
Dave Townsend
6c649be569
Bug 793928: Switch users of the promise library to the new location and move tests files. r=gavin
...
--HG--
rename : toolkit/addon-sdk/test/Makefile.in => addon-sdk/test/Makefile.in
rename : toolkit/addon-sdk/test/unit/head.js => addon-sdk/test/unit/head.js
rename : toolkit/addon-sdk/test/unit/test_promise.js => addon-sdk/test/unit/test_promise.js
rename : toolkit/addon-sdk/test/unit/xpcshell.ini => addon-sdk/test/unit/xpcshell.ini
2013-02-01 11:43:15 -08:00
Mark Finkle
e12320ead1
Bug 837215 - YouTube video's redirect on play; broken on tablets r=bnicholson
2013-02-01 15:21:37 -05:00
Scott Johnson
db9e0a6310
Bug 830645: Allow reflow-on-zoom to happen on page-load. [r=kats]
2013-01-31 14:55:22 -06:00
Ryan VanderMeulen
69a41795c3
Backed out changesets 9aadf7e35e70 (bug 836517) and 493805ba1c85 (bug 834681) for Android test hangs.
2013-01-31 15:15:50 -05:00
Margaret Leibovic
cf02c90bbc
Bug 836517 - Lightweight theme support for distributions. r=mfinkle
2013-01-31 10:28:42 -08:00